Which body is responsible for preparing the Budget as per the text?
Department of Economic Affairs
How is the Budget classified in the Union Budget as per the text?
Revenue Budget and Capital Budget
In which houses of Parliament is the annual financial statement laid before as per Article 112?
Both Lok Sabha and Rajya Sabha
What is the basis of preparation for the Budget according to the text?
Cash Basis
Who presents the budget in the Parliament according to the text?
Union Finance Minister
Which part of the budget consists of various schemes and priorities announced by the government?
Part A
What are the two main components of the Union Budget mentioned in the text?
Revenue Budget and Capital Budget
What is the purpose of the Fiscal Policy Statements mandated under the FRBM Act?
To outline the government's strategy to achieve fiscal targets
Which document provides a summary of the government's expenditure and revenue for the upcoming fiscal year?
Budget at a Glance
What is the significance of the Medium-Term Fiscal Policy cum Fiscal Policy Strategy Statement?
It outlines the government's long-term fiscal policy goals and strategies
Which document explains in detail the government's plans to implement budget announcements from the previous fiscal year?
Implementation of Budget Announcements, 2023-24
What does the Annual Financial Statement under Article 112 primarily focus on?
Expenditure projections for the upcoming fiscal year
